vs代码键绑定(在终端中运行python脚本)不再有效

时间:2018-02-02 08:45:26

标签: python visual-studio-code key-bindings

一段时间以来,我在VS Code中有一个键绑定,它运行我在终端上工作的python脚本。

到目前为止,这一直没有问题,直到今天我才开始收到以下错误:

警告:无法读取属性&to toCommandArgument'未定义的

我正在使用Anaconda环境,并尝试更新到最新版本的vscode(1.19.3),但这并没有解决我的问题。

我没有更改环境或更改了代码。它刚刚停止工作

到目前为止,我已尝试删除并将键绑定重新分配给另一个键序列,结果相同。

有关如何解决此问题的任何想法?

1 个答案:

答案 0 :(得分:2)

我有几乎相同的症状。在最后一次扩展更新(它是MS-Python 2018.1.0和GitHistory 0.4.0更新)后,我在“终端中运行Python文件”的键绑定开始下拉警告:“路径必须是一个字符串。收到未定义”。同时通过上下文菜单运行文件仍然可以。在一些谷歌搜索后,我试图删除我的自定义用户设置“python.terminal.executeInFileDir”:true,默认情况下为False。 Henrik说,警告改为“无法读取未定义的属性'toCommandArgument”。

编辑: 内部人员修复此问题: https://pvsc.blob.core.windows.net/extension-builds/ms-python-insiders.vsix